Handover — Insurance Renewal

From: D. Marwick, outgoing Director of Operations
To: T. Olvane, incoming

The Grayline Mutual policy lapses end of Q2. Renewal quote received; premium up 14% due to the Harwick depot claim. Broker pushed back once, got 2% off. Counteroffer from Vantor Assurance pending — expect it within ten days. Finance team has the comparison sheet. Do not sign before the Vantor numbers land. Deductibles unchanged, cyber rider still excluded. Flag anything odd to me before Friday. Context below on where this fits strategically.

board note of kageg-bahof: The renewal with Holwynax Holdings closes at $2 million a year, 5 percent below the last contract. Project Ulaath slips by two quarters because of the supplier delay.

Handover Note — Retail Pilot

To the incoming director: the Lanthorn Goods pilot is in month three of six. Shelf placement in twelve stores is performing above forecast, though returns in the Keld region run high. Weekly check-ins with their merchandising lead are established. Contracts and performance data sit in the shared drive. The confidential background you need appears directly below.

confidential, kagap-kajeg: Istethax Holdings is in early talks to buy Ulaielix Works for about $23.7 million. The Lamys launch date is July 6, and nothing goes to the press before then.

### Step 3: Migrate Flag Definitions

Move all rollout rules from Togglewright v1 YAML into the new Lanternswitch schema. Percentage-based rollouts must declare a salt explicitly; v1's implicit salting is gone. Run the converter once per environment, then diff against the audit log. The converter expects the following defaults to be present before it runs.

settings of tawig-hawef:
[zorath]
port = 7000
region = north-1
host = zorath.tolvaqworks.corp
timeout_ms = 1000
retries = 1